Commercial fire restoration services involve a comprehensive process to repair and recover properties damaged by fire. When a fire occurs in a business or commercial building, it can cause extensive damage to structures, walls, ceilings, and contents. These specialists assess the extent of the damage, remove debris and soot, and perform cleaning and repairs to restore the property to a safe and functional condition. The goal is to address both visible damage and underlying issues such as smoke infiltration, lingering odors, and compromised structural elements to ensure the property is fully restored.
This service helps solve a variety of problems associated with fire incidents. Beyond the obvious structural damage, fires often leave behind smoke residue that can stain surfaces and cause persistent odors. Fire and smoke can also weaken building materials, leading to potential safety hazards if not properly repaired. Additionally, water used to extinguish the fire can cause water damage, mold growth, and further deterioration. Commercial fire restoration aims to eliminate these issues, preventing further damage and reducing the risk of health problems caused by mold, soot, and residual smoke particles.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Fire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Auburn,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or fire damage restoration, such as cleaning soot and minor repairs, gener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ials involved.
Moderate Restoration - Larger projects involving extensive cleaning, debris removal, and partial repairs usually c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These are common for moderate fire incidents affecting multiple areas of a property.
Major Reconstruction - Significant fire damage requiring structural repairs, replacement of drywall, flooring, or cabinetry can range from $4,000 to $10,000 or more. Fewer projects reach into this higher tier, often depending on the size and complexity of the restoration.
Full Property Replacement - In cases of severe fire destruction, total rebuilds or complete property replacements can exceed $20,000. Such extensive projects are less frequent but handled by local contractors for comprehensive restoration need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
